Match Overview: A Tale of Two Contrasting Seasons
Kolkata Knight Riders, captained by the veteran Ajinkya Rahane, find themselves in a precarious position. With five losses and one no-result in their first six games, every match is now a knockout for them. On the other hand, Rajasthan Royals have been the team to beat. With four wins in five matches, they are currently perched at the third spot on the points table. The narrative of this match centers on whether KKR’s experienced core can halt the momentum of RR’s explosive youngsters.
Pitch Report: The Eden Gardens Surface
Eden Gardens is legendary for its pace and bounce, but for this afternoon clash on April 19, 2026, the surface presents a different challenge.
Dry Nature: The groundstaff have prepared a dry wicket with minimal grass cover.
Spin Factor: As an afternoon start (3:30 PM IST), the sun will bake the surface, likely causing it to crack and slow down as the game progresses.
Historical Trends: In afternoon games at this venue, the ball tends to grip more. Spinners like Varun Chakaravarthy and Ravi Bishnoi are expected to play a massive role.
The Toss Factor
In the match today, Rajasthan Royals won the toss and elected to bat first. Captain Riyan Parag noted that the wicket looked dry and believed that setting a target would be the best strategy to avoid the pitch slowing down during a chase. KKR skipper Ajinkya Rahane mentioned he was “happy to lose the toss,” hoping his bowlers could exploit any early moisture before the pitch becomes a spinner’s paradise.

Head-to-Head Statistics
Historically, this has been one of the most balanced rivalries in IPL history.
| Metric | Details |
| Total Matches Played | 32 |
| KKR Wins | 16 |
| RR Wins | 14 |
| No Result/Tied | 2 |
| KKR Highest Score | 223 |
| RR Highest Score | 224 |
While KKR leads the overall tally by a slim margin, RR has dominated the recent encounters, including high-scoring thrillers in 2024 and 2025.
Key Players to Watch
1. Riyan Parag (RR)
The RR captain has been in the form of his life. His ability to anchor the innings and finish with a flourish makes him the most dangerous batter in the lineup. His captaincy has also been lauded for its tactical sharpness.
2. Cameron Green (KKR)
Green showed glimpses of his destructive best in the previous game. On a pitch that might offer a bit of bounce for the tall fast-bowling all-rounder, he will be KKR’s X-factor with both bat and ball.
3. Varun Chakaravarthy (KKR)
With the pitch expected to turn, the “Mystery Spinner” holds the key. If he can dismantle the RR middle order during the middle overs, KKR stands a real chance of an upset.
4. Yashasvi Jaiswal (RR)
Jaiswal remains a threat at the top of the order. His aggressive approach in the Powerplay can take the game away from KKR before their spinners even come into the attack.
